Is a Radon Inspection Required?

Radon is irradiated gas created naturally from the decay of uranium and radium in soil, rock, and water. It is invisible, odorless, and flavorless, which renders it challenging to identify without specialized gear.

The health risks related to radon exposure are mainly associated with the breathing of radon gas and the decay products it creates. When inhaled, radon can destroy lung tissue and raise the chance of developing lung cancer. Per the World Health Organization (WHO), radon is the second leading cause of lung cancer after smoking and contributes to an estimated 15% of lung cancer deaths worldwide.

What Spaces Inside the Home Are Most at Risk of Toxic Radon Accumulation?

Radon gas can be present in any home whatever its condition or location. Radon gas flows into a home through the ground and typically collects in the lower storeys. Some of the most common places where radon gas can amass and that a radon inspector will concentrate on include:

  • Cellars and crawl spaces: The most probable place where radon gas builds up are basements and crawl spaces owing to their closeness to the ground. Your radon inspector shall prioritize testing on these areas and inspect for cracks and gaps in the structure that permit the gas to penetrate.
  • First floor: Any portion of a dwelling in contact with the ground has the potential to be vulnerable to hazardous concentrations of radon gas. All habitable spaces that are on the first floor should undergo an adequate radon inspection to provide peace of mind.
  • Water wells: Radon has the ability to break down into groundwater and become discharged into the air when the water is utilized, hence water sources should also undergo radon testing.
  • Pump systems: Often, pump systems are installed in basements and crawl spaces to prevent flooding, however, if they are not adequately sealed, they may increase the chance of radon gas infiltrating the home.
  • Construction joints: The gas has the potential to enter a home through gaps in construction joints, for instance where partitions and floors converge.

Radon levels can fluctuate widely even within the same home, so it's crucial to have competent radon testing done to receive accurate data.

A radon home inspection with our professionals will generally consist of:

  • Placement of radon test devices: A proficient inspector will position one or more radon testing devices on the ground level of your house, such as the cellar or crawlspace. The equipment is left in place for a certain amount of time, usually between 48 hours to a week, depending on the kind of device used.
  • Measurement of radon levels: The radon testing devices collect air samples, which are subsequently assessed in a laboratory to establish the typical radon level in your residence.
  • Reporting of results: Pillar to Post™ will deliver a detailed report of the radon inspection results after the completion of the laboratory analysis. The report will include the typical radon level in your house and any recommended next steps in case the levels go beyond the EPA's suggested threshold.

It's important to note that radon levels can fluctuate over time, so performing a radon home inspection at least every two years is advisable. Additionally, we suggest conducting a follow-up test if the initial test results reveal elevated levels of radon to confirm the findings and ascertain if remediation is necessary.
